Bylaws are the internal rules that govern the corporation's operations and are typically filed with the state. A shareholder agreement is a contract between shareholders that outlines their rights, responsibilities, and relationship with the corporation. Both documents work together to provide a comprehensive governance framework.

Yes, bylaws can be amended as your organization evolves. The amendment process is typically outlined in the bylaws themselves and usually requires board approval and sometimes shareholder approval. Board members have three primary fiduciary duties: the duty of care (acting with reasonable care and diligence), the duty of loyalty (acting in the best interests of the organization), and the duty of obedience (ensuring the organization follows its mission and complies with laws).
